The Toa Electronics DM-1200 is a handheld cardioid dynamic microphone offering a frequency response tailored for reproduction of vocals and speech in concert venues, lectures, houses of worship, and presentations. Its dynamic element requires no power source and delivers a frequency response of 50 Hz to 12 kHz. The cardioid polar pattern rejects sound behind the mic, yielding enhanced immunity to feedback and decreased pickup of room ambience.
An on/off switch is provided for convenient muting of the mic between speeches or performances. The DM-1200 features a rugged die-cast zinc body that is made to withstand the rigors of heavy road use.
